1. "Biodesign: The Process of Innovating Medical Technologies" by Paul G. Yock et al.
Why It’s Essential: This influential book provides a structured methodology for developing innovative medical devices and technologies, offering step-by-step guidance from concept through to market entry.
Key Takeaways:
Understanding the biodesign innovation process
Techniques for identifying unmet clinical needs
Practical insights on regulatory, reimbursement, and commercialisation strategies
Career Relevance: Essential for UK roles involving product development, innovation management, and entrepreneurship within the medtech industry.
2. "Medical Device Development: Regulation and Law" by Jonathan S. Kahan
Why It’s Essential: A comprehensive guide to understanding the complex regulatory landscape for medical devices, essential for compliance and market entry in the UK and internationally.
Key Takeaways:
Overview of regulatory requirements for medical devices
Strategies for navigating EU MDR, FDA, and UK-specific frameworks
Practical insights into quality assurance and product approval
Career Relevance: Critical for regulatory affairs specialists, compliance officers, and quality assurance professionals within the UK medtech sector.
3. "Digital Health: Scaling Healthcare to the World" by Homero Rivas and Katarzyna Wac
Why It’s Essential: An insightful resource that explores how digital technologies are transforming healthcare delivery, improving patient outcomes, and creating new business opportunities.
Key Takeaways:
Detailed insights into digital health technologies such as telemedicine, mobile health, and AI
Case studies of successful digital health deployments
Guidance on the ethical and regulatory considerations of digital health
Career Relevance: Highly relevant for digital health roles, healthcare informatics specialists, and innovation leads in UK healthcare and medtech startups.
4. "The Medical Device R&D Handbook" by Theodore R. Kucklick
Why It’s Essential: This practical handbook offers detailed guidance on medical device research and development, providing industry best practices and real-world applications.
Key Takeaways:
Comprehensive coverage of R&D processes
Insights into prototyping, testing, and validation
Guidance on ensuring compliance and achieving successful product launches
Career Relevance: Ideal for product engineers, R&D professionals, and project managers within UK medtech companies.
5. "Introduction to Biomedical Engineering" by John Enderle and Joseph Bronzino
Why It’s Essential: A foundational text providing comprehensive insights into biomedical engineering, crucial for anyone working at the intersection of engineering and healthcare.
Key Takeaways:
Essential biomedical engineering principles and applications
Detailed analysis of biomechanics, biomaterials, and medical imaging
Practical understanding of medical instrumentation
Career Relevance: Vital for roles in biomedical engineering, medical device manufacturing, and clinical engineering positions in hospitals and companies across the UK.

7. "Clinical Engineering Handbook" edited by Ernesto Iadanza
Why It’s Essential: An authoritative reference covering the roles and responsibilities of clinical engineers, crucial for healthcare technology management and patient safety.
Key Takeaways:
Comprehensive guidelines on clinical equipment management
Insights into healthcare technology assessments
Best practices in maintaining and troubleshooting medical technology
Career Relevance: Indispensable for clinical engineers, equipment managers, and biomedical technicians employed in NHS hospitals and private healthcare providers across the UK.
